Shia Islam Religion and Spirituality


There are two main branches of Islam, the Sunni and the Shia. Shia is the smaller branch and consists of 15% of the Muslim population worldwide. Most Shias (known in the west as Twelvers, or Ithnasheris) believe in 12 divinely appointed successors of Prophet Mohammed, but there are significant groups who believe in only 5 or 7 Imams. Shias are in the majority in Iran and Iraq.
